返回
赶走“距离感”,缓动公式你必须懂!
前端
2024-01-12 12:00:22
缓动公式,又称Tween算法,是一种用于控制动画效果的数学函数。它可以使动画在开始和结束时以不同的速度运行,从而产生更加平滑、自然的效果。缓动公式在网页设计、游戏开发、视频制作等领域都有着广泛的应用。
缓动公式的原理其实很简单。它通过一个函数来控制动画元素在一段时间内的运动速度。这个函数通常是平滑的曲线,在动画开始时速度较慢,然后逐渐加速,最后在动画结束时速度再次减慢。这样一来,动画元素就会产生一种更加自然的运动效果。
缓动公式有很多种,每种公式都有不同的运动特性。在CSS中,我们常用的缓动公式包括:
- linear:线性运动,速度恒定。
- ease:缓和运动,开始和结束时速度较慢,中间速度较快。
- ease-in:渐入运动,开始时速度较慢,然后逐渐加速。
- ease-out:渐出运动,开始时速度较快,然后逐渐减慢。
- ease-in-out:渐入渐出运动,开始和结束时速度较慢,中间速度较快。
除了这些常用的缓动公式外,CSS还提供了许多其他的缓动公式,可以满足不同的需求。
使用缓动公式可以实现各种各样的动画效果。比如,我们可以使用缓动公式来让元素淡入淡出、移动、旋转、缩放等。缓动公式还可以用来创建复杂的动画效果,比如让元素沿着一條贝塞尔曲线运动。
缓动公式在网页设计、游戏开发、视频制作等领域都有着广泛的应用。掌握了缓动公式,你就能实现更加惊艳的动画效果,让你的作品更加生动有趣。
缓动公式的应用实例
缓动公式在网页设计、游戏开发、视频制作等领域都有着广泛的应用。以下是一些缓动公式的应用实例:
- 网页设计:缓动公式可以用来实现各种各样的网页动画效果,比如让元素淡入淡出、移动、旋转、缩放等。缓动公式还可以用来创建复杂的动画效果,比如让元素沿着一條贝塞尔曲线运动。
- 游戏开发:缓动公式可以用来实现各种各样的游戏动画效果,比如角色移动、攻击、死亡等。缓动公式还可以用来创建复杂的动画效果,比如让角色在空中飞舞、在水中游泳等。
- 视频制作:缓动公式可以用来实现各种各样的视频动画效果,比如镜头移动、字幕滚动、特效渲染等。缓动公式还可以用来创建复杂的动画效果,比如让视频中的角色跳舞、说话等。
缓动公式的优势
缓动公式具有以下优势:
- 可以让动画效果更加平滑、自然。
- 可以实现各种各样的动画效果。
- 可以满足不同的需求。
- 易于使用。
缓动公式的局限性
缓动公式也存在一些局限性:
- 可能需要花费大量时间来调整参数才能达到满意的效果。
- 可能会增加文件的体积。
- 在某些情况下,缓动公式可能会导致动画效果不稳定。
结论
缓动公式是一种强大的工具,可以用来实现各种各样的动画效果。掌握了缓动公式,你就能让你的作品更加生动有趣。